The Allure of Risk and Reward

The thrill of gambling often stems from the potential for substantial rewards juxtaposed against the risks involved. This inherent risk-reward dynamic taps into our primal instincts, making gambling feel exhilarating. Such experiences can lead to heightened emotions, further fueling the desire to participate.

Moreover, the anticipation surrounding each game can trigger the release of dopamine, a neurotransmitter associated with pleasure and reward. This chemical response reinforces the behavior of gambling, causing players to seek out that euphoric feeling again and again, despite the possibility of loss.

Social Influence and Peer Pressure

Human beings are inherently social creatures, and the influence of peers can significantly impact gambling behavior. Many individuals begin their gambling journeys in social settings, whether it’s at a casino with friends or through online platforms that incorporate chat features. This social aspect can create a sense of camaraderie, encouraging players to take risks they might avoid in isolation.

Additionally, observing others win can intensify the urge to gamble. Players may feel motivated to join in the excitement, believing that they too can achieve similar success. This social validation can sometimes lead to reckless betting, driven more by the desire to fit in than by rational decision-making.

Cognitive Biases and Illusions of Control

Cognitive biases play a crucial role in gambling behavior. Many players fall prey to the illusion of control, where they believe their skills or strategies can influence outcomes that are fundamentally random. This false sense of control can lead to increased gambling frequency as players feel empowered to beat the odds.

Additionally, the gambler’s fallacy—the belief that past events will influence future outcomes—can further entrench this behavior. Players may think that a winning streak is destined to continue or that they are “due” for a win after a series of losses. Such cognitive distortions can cloud judgment, making it difficult for individuals to recognize when it’s time to stop gambling.

The Role of Emotion in Gambling Decisions

Emotions significantly influence gambling behavior, often leading to impulsive decisions. When players experience stress, boredom, or anxiety, they may turn to gambling as a coping mechanism. The emotional highs and lows associated with gambling can provide an escape from everyday pressures, creating a cycle of behavior that’s hard to break.

Moreover, emotional responses can distort risk assessment. Excitement and euphoria might encourage players to take larger risks, while feelings of sadness or frustration may lead them to chase losses. Understanding these emotional triggers is vital for both players and those who care about them, as it can help inform strategies for responsible gambling.
